Applications of 3D Printing in Education

Traditional ways of teaching are made up of paper and textbooks only. Luckily, 3D printing technology has been considered in primary, secondary, and university education . Educators can now present physical objects to their students to understand concepts. Some educational applications are the following:

Medicine - Exploring healthcare and medicine has been made easy by 3D printing technology. Human organs can now be printed to improve simulation and training for future surgeons. It also helps in developing prosthetic devices.

Biology - Biology students can now have a better understanding of the behavior of living things. Cells and other biological structures can be patterned in 3D models and printed.

Chemistry - 3D printing technology in chemistry helps in producing complex laboratory devices. Moreover, molecules can be converted into a 3D model and printed for better learning.

Engineering - More engineering students are using 3D printing technology in their designs. These designs can then be printed as prototypes. Making testing and problem solving quicker.

Architecture - Architect students can now also print their 3D model designs. Providing a better way to communicate their design ideas and site plans.

History - Historical artifacts can be recreated using 3D printing technology. Students are able to examine these artifacts in their own hands. Giving life to past and important events.

Geography - Learning Geography was made interesting by 3D printing technology. Educators can provide students with 3D models to explore the desired area. Examining topographies, maps, and other geographic information.

Automotive - 3D printing is also helpful in learning automotive. Students can now print auto parts for replacement and testing.

Graphic Design - Graphic designs can be patterned to a 3D model. Leveling up with 3D printing technology, students can now print their artworks.

Culinary - 3D models of food products guide culinary students. It helps students to visualize food presentations. A great way in eliminating waste on food products.

Benefits of 3D Printing in Education

Better Way of Learning - 3D printing technology helps in getting students’ attention. It allows educators to have a real-life representation of their lesson plans. Fixing the gap between motionless images to interactive physical objects.

Hands-On Approach - Seeing and touching a real-life object improves learning. 3D printing promotes a hands-on approach to learning. Allowing students to understand and remember subjects easily.

Interactive Engagement - 3D printing is a new technology. Thus, it creates excitement among students. It helps to attract and engage students. Even hesitant learners can find it interesting. Thus, it improves communication among students and educators. It also helps in better collaboration and building camaraderie.

Optimize Creativity - There’s more room for creativity when it comes to 3D printing. Any students who are involved in this technology can innovate 3D models. It brings back traditional art in a more leveraged way.

Improves Problem-Solving Skills - 3D printing technology helps to identify problems through prototypes. This allows students to observe and come out with possible solutions ahead of time. It also enhances their critical thinking, design thinking, and iterative development.

Learning Possibilities - The use of 3D printing technology becomes in-demand in education. It gives students access to information that was unavailable before. Thus, opens new possibilities for learning.

Creating Awareness - Real-world problems can be seen using 3D printing technology. This technology may help students to see the challenges in their communities. Making them more aware of what’s happening. Also, gives them the opportunity to empathize with the people around them. Who knows, someday they’ll become the future problem solvers.
